People decry for non-payment of funds under MGNREGA, BDO Marheen unmoved

Early Times Report

Kathua June 18: A large number of beneficiaries of sanitary facility under Central sponsored MGNREGA scheme have been resenting repeatedly approaching to the office of Block Development Officer (BDO) at Marheen for liability and pending installments from where they always got mere assurances.
The beneficiaries have been bemoaning for over 2 years as ironically person who is nodal officer to look into matter always turns a deaf hear and ignores the suffering of poor people.
According to a scheme under NREGA, Rural Development Department has asked people to construct sanitary (toilets) facility in their houses and government will provide financial assistance in three equal installments.
"But in our case only one installment has been released while 66% amount is still balanced, locals lamented and said that they have to construct toilets at their own as in the want of due funds which government failed to prove they managed personal loans to finish the construction in halfway.
Shiv Dev Singh, a social worker and beneficiary informed that VLW suggested people to construct toilets in their house and government provides finance after completion of construction work. Singh said poor people with enthusiasm started construction work even after borrowing money from their relatives.
"It was surprising that many of us got only one installment i.e. Rs 5000/- few years back and rest is yet to be paid," he alleged.
Singh said whenever they approached BDO Marheen, he mostly was found absent from duty without any entry in movement register. He alleged that BDO always adopt a dillydallying approach to release the pending payments to beneficiaries.
Sham Lal, a local said, "Official in BDO office openly demanded due share from amount meant for construction of toilets." He also alleged that BDO officials released cheques of only those who allegedly have greased his palms which is not possible for some poor people of area. Lal said the matter was also highlighted before DDC Kathua during a public interaction and MLA Hiranagar too but nothing has been done in this regard.
Meantime at BDO’s office, the BDO was found absent from duty from June 15 without any information in movement in register.
ET reporter when contacted Tehsildar Marheen, he first ensured to verify absenteeism at BDO Office and assured that all the funds under MGNREGA will be released within days after discussing the matter with concerned BDO and DDC Kathua.
